### Runbook: Report export timezone mismatches (Glimmerfield)

If a customer reports that exported totals differ from the dashboard, check whether their report schedule predates the March cutover — older schedules still render in server-local time rather than the account timezone. Re-saving the schedule fixes it. Before escalating, confirm the export worker is running with the expected timezone settings shown below.

config for kadup-kajog:
[raldor]
host = raldor.tolvaqworks.internal
user = raldor_svc
database = raldor_prod

QUARTERLY PLANNING NOTE — FINANCE

Subject: Legacy Pricing, Bramlet Tools

From next quarter, legacy Bramlet Tools subscribers move to current list pricing, an average uplift of 7%. Invoicing changes take effect on renewal dates, not mid-term. Finance should update forecast models and flag accounts with contractual caps by the 15th. The broader plan informing this change follows below.

internal memo for kawip-hadug: Headcount on the Wenwyn team goes from 7 to 140 by the end of January. Gross margin on Wenwyn came in at 20 percent against a plan of 15 percent.

**Q: How do I regenerate a failed invoice PDF in Quillbatch?**

A: Most rendering failures come from malformed line-item data, not the renderer itself. Re-run the job from the Quillbatch admin console after validating the source JSON. If the render worker pool itself is down, you'll need to restart it from the recovery console, which requires the operator passphrase. New team members get this during their first week from the platform lead. For reference, the current passphrase is noted here:

strongbox words: ulaael-wenix

## v3.2.0 — Changed Defaults

StockPilot's restock planner now ships with conservative defaults. The route optimizer previously assumed a 45-minute service window per machine; this is now 30 minutes, which may affect plugins that compute driver schedules. Demand forecasting also defaults to the seasonal model instead of the rolling average. Plugin authors should verify their overrides still apply after upgrade, since unset keys now inherit the new values. The full set of shipped defaults is listed here.

deployment values, kajep-kageg:
[praix]
host = praix.paliqcorp.corp
user = praix_svc
database = praix_prod